The ZMM55C22 is a Zener diode manufactured by Cystech Electronics Corp. It is designed to provide a stable voltage reference or voltage regulation in various electronic circuits. This diode comes in a small MiniMELF (SOD-80) package, making it suitable for space-constrained applications.

Additional Details:
The ZMM55C22 has a nominal Zener voltage (Vz) of 22V with a tolerance that varies based on the specific grade. The Zener voltage is measured at a specified test current (Izt). The MiniMELF (SOD-80) package offers good thermal dissipation capabilities, allowing the diode to handle moderate power levels. The diode is designed to withstand high surge currents, making it suitable for protecting sensitive circuits from voltage spikes. The low reverse leakage current (Ir) minimizes power loss and improves efficiency. The excellent clamping capability ensures that the voltage across the diode remains stable even under varying load conditions. The operating temperature range is typically -65°C to +175°C. It's crucial to check the datasheet for the diode's power dissipation rating, which will dictate the maximum current it can handle in the application without damage.
